Before diving into the checklist, let’s briefly discuss why lease audits are crucial. A lease audit is not just about verifying financial accuracy – it’s a comprehensive evaluation of your lease agreements, expenditures, controls, and compliance measures. Auditors assess whether your financial transactions align with the terms of your leases and identify any potential risks of fraud or mismanagement.
A well-prepared audit expedites the process and instills confidence in auditors and stakeholders. Properly documenting your lease transactions, ensuring compliance with accounting standards, and validating payments demonstrate your commitment to transparency and accuracy.
